The Queen's Navy
A BENSATIONAL STATEMENT. (PKB PRKB9 ASSOCIATION). London, August 29. la « docusaiaa in tUo House or Commons on the Navy Estimates, Sir U. Kay<Shuttlewortb, Secretary to tho Admiralty, auuounced lhat it was the intention of tho Government to materially strengthen the Mediterranean fleet. Sir Edward J. Keed, M.P. for Cardiff, named twelve of the iirst-class warships which he declared would turn turtle like HM.S. Victoria if they were rammed, as they were of faulty construction. This statement created a sensation in the House.
